Offers a portrait of a photographer extraordinaire - Arnold Newman. His subtle arrangements constituted the foundations of 'environmental portraiture.' His photographs integrate the respective artist's characteristic equipment and surroundings. This work includes his work and a biography, and provides an overview of Newman's illustrious career.
